Akindele-Bello Olufunke Ayotunde (popularly known as Funke Akindele /Jenifa) is a Nigerian actress and producer. She starred in the sitcom I Need to Know from 1998 to 2002, and in 2009, won the Africa Movie Academy Award for Best Actress in a Leading Role.

- We need to shoot more movies that promote and celebrate our culture. Right now, it should be all about presenting our stories to the Western world. I think Nollywood needs to shoot more indigenous, historical movies to tell our stories like ‘Sango’ and all of that. We can change the Nigerian narrative through our films. I believe Nigerian filmmakers have a lot of power in their hands to change our society and even hold our politicians accountable.
- [4] On her Interview with PREMIUM TIMES on how Nollywood can change the Nigerian narrative
